“I’m here, whole,” Lula declared, gesturing energetically and sporting a hat. “I’m healed. I just need to take care of myself.” His medical team has cleared him to return to work but advised against long-haul international flights and strenuous activity for at least a month.
Health and Recovery Plans
Doctors confirmed that Lula would continue his recovery at home in São Paulo and is unlikely to travel to the capital, BrasÃlia, until after a CT scan scheduled for Thursday. The scan will provide further insights into his recovery progress.
Political Implications
Lula’s health scare has raised concerns among political analysts, particularly regarding succession plans within the Workers’ Party if the president is unable to seek reelection in 2026. Despite these uncertainties, Lula’s optimistic demeanor aimed to reassure both supporters and critics.
Response to Braga Netto Arrest
During his first public remarks since hospitalization, Lula addressed the recent arrest of Walter Braga Netto, a former defense minister and vice-presidential candidate alongside far-right ex-President Jair Bolsonaro. Braga Netto, a retired general, is accused by federal police of conspiring to stage a coup and plotting to assassinate Lula following his narrow 2022 election victory over Bolsonaro.
“It’s unacceptable that in a generous country like Brazil, we have people of high military rank plotting the death of a president,” Lula stated firmly.
